Introduction: Thank you for supporting this community project. The FW3A was designed by Fritz 15 & the flashlight forums TLFBLF. Brought to life by Lumintop. It is an ultra-compact & high-intensity flashlight with the only 92.5mm in length, & it delivers a max 2800 lumens amazing output by one 18650 battery. The metal & electronic tail switch control various functions including smooth ramping, stepped mode setting, strobe, etc. It is the EDC flashlight choice best if you are a flashaholic, flashlight collector, etc.FW3A Copper is the copper material version FW3A.
